Sat 1377433473885396

decimal
340973.973885396
degree
0°130973′269″973885396‴
percentile
65.59207025717016%
name
ecbcbnaqulx
cycle
0
epoch
1
period
169
block
340973
offset
973885396
timestamp
rarity
common